•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

equalsraf / telos / 161
73%
master: 73%

Build:
Build:
LAST BUILD BRANCH: tb-infra
DEFAULT BRANCH: master
Ran 13 Feb 2016 07:18PM UTC
Jobs 3
Files 17
Run time 17s
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

pending completion
161

push

travis-ci

equalsraf
TlsStream: that ownership of underlying stream

This breaks compatibility: from_socket() is renamed
connect_socket() and accept() to accept_socket(), this
is aligned with the naming in libtls, it also makes things
more clear.

It not always intuitive that dropping the holder of file
descriptor will close the socket, so I used a generic to
enable keeping the inner stream object inside the TlsStream.

There are downsides which I have yet to address:

1. With generics the type of the inner stream is part
   of the type - this may be undesirable.
2. connect_socket() and accept_socket() are still using
   the generic, which makes little sense.

1131 of 1550 relevant lines covered (72.97%)

2.19 hits per line

Jobs
ID Job ID Ran Files Coverage
1 161.1 13 Feb 2016 07:18PM UTC 0
72.95
Travis Job 161.1
2 161.2 13 Feb 2016 07:18PM UTC 0
72.97
Travis Job 161.2
3 161.3 (PUSH_DOCS=1) 13 Feb 2016 07:18PM UTC 0
72.95
Travis Job 161.3
Source Files on build 161
Detailed source file information is not available for this build.
  • Back to Repo
  • Travis Build #161
  • 2509e5af on github
  • Next Build on tb-rawfd (#162)
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2026 Coveralls, Inc